Output 78650192430f0f3cd577d3155191e66c7a710ac92a0b6b0af675bc3cc2146034:4

value
2706034862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d28a2097def769c741c7d33c7790db8c5f98871 OP_EQUALVERIFY OP_CHECKSIG
address
LSFvyDD9pqAPSs27nrcErVXFqAbExAovtH
transaction
78650192430f0f3cd577d3155191e66c7a710ac92a0b6b0af675bc3cc2146034
spent
true